Gold’s price potential still ‘explosive’ amid Beijing hoarding, Hong Kong trading push
South China Morning Post
Gold prices have “explosive” upside potential, according to analysts, boding well for Hong Kong’s ambitions as a trading hub as Asian central banks continue to have a voracious appetite for stockpiling bullion. Supporting the outlook, Beijing – which has added to its gold reserve for 20 straight months – wants to better connect the Shanghai Gold Exchange to Hong Kong, and the South Korean central bank plans to buy gold for the first time in 13 years. “Gold remains in an explosive phase of the...
